look 3

Navy and rust are such an amazing combo, especially if you’re not a huge fan of wearing black. I am wearing a ribbed navy sweater paired with a jean jacket for a laid-back feel. Because it the sweater is a boat-neck, I simply added a thick wool scarf to keep me warm when riding. This is one of my favourite city and stable looks!

Look 4

Having a solid bottom allows you to play around with patterns up top, and that’s exactly what I’m doing here. This sweater is from Tribal and I absolutely love it! Not only does it go with these rust breeches, but anything you could think of! This four season sweater will brighten any look, all while keeping you warm. The criss-cross on the back adds a little pizzaz when you’re walking, trotting, and cantering away. The jean jacket ties everything together for the Autumn temperatures, if you’re still a bit chilly add a cozy scarf!
